steeners81 Posted September 28, 2011 Author #77 Share Posted September 28, 2011 I really wanted to try the seafood shack because I had heard really bad thing and really good things about and I wanted to judge for myself. Plus they had coconut shrimp. First up for an app we had the coconut shrimp which was delicious, the only thing I didn’t like is usually coconut comes with some sort of sweet dipping sauce and this didn’t. And we also had the Cajun popcorn shrimp I then had the grilled Cajun platter with the Cajun potato wedges. It was excellent I don’t even like fish fillets and I actually enjoyed this We also decided to share the seafood basket for 2 with sweet potato fried. I only tried a piece of a scallop but it was tasty. I loved the sweet potato fries. I really wanted to try the banana split but I was way to stuffed. Hypo Posted September 29, 2011 #98 Share Posted September 29, 2011 You can get escargot nearly every night on Oasis. Just ask you head waiter if he would special order escargot for you for every night that you want them. we did and had them four nights. He must have the order at least twenty four hours in advance of the dinner when you wish to eat them. this also applies for any other special request menu items that you might wish to have.
